Resolving merge conflicts git and github for poets in this video, i look at how to resolve a merge conflict using the github interface. What unmet needs impact the difficulty of a merge conflict resolution. Our ebooks are ideal for anyone who wants to learn about or develop their interpersonal skills and are full of easytofollow, practical information. Predicting merge conflicts in collaborative software development. Software practitioners perspective on merge conflicts and resolution. Interpersonal conflict is a fact of life and can arise in almost any sphere, from organisations through to personal relationships.
An empirical examination of the relationship between code. A project manager should make use of the confronting technique in all cases because all the reference books suggested that it is the best conflict resolution technique. Sources of conflict and methods of conflict resolution ron fisher, ph. Resolving conflict without giving in or giving up step one.
Pdf conflict resolution for structured merge via version space. In conflict resolution, you must learn to work to achieve your goals, keep your cool while compromising, and work to maintain effective relationships. Conflict management is one of the core training courses we offer for managers and supervisors. Conflict resolution and group dynamics objectives participants will develop personal and group problem solving skills. We design a classifier for predicting merge conflicts, based on 9.
The research suggests that the full impact of the recent changes in legislation has still to come. Opensource practitioners n1 how easy is it to understand the code involved in the merge conflict n2 your. The key is not to avoid conflict but to learn how to resolve it in a healthy way. Ten strategies for conflict resolution when angry, separate yourself from the situation and take time to cool out. First, lets take a look at the conflict you are facing using the stopthinkact model. Free how to resolve conflicts online course volunteer ministers. After all, two people cant be expected to agree on everything, all the time.
This paper offers a few strategies derived from the methods of sociodrama, psychodrama, role playing, and group dynamics that may be helpful in working out some of the arguments which come into your life. Sep 21, 2016 5 keys to effective conflict resolution. Individuals who are able to resolve conflicts are often excellent mediators, rational, and able to manage difficult. Work related to merge conflict resolution researchers have also studied different ways of managing the merge of developers changes to efficiently resolve conflicts. Asking questions the average fiveyearold asks 65 questions per day, most of them starting with why. Youre not always going to get along with your friends and family, and they wont. Git will mark the file as being conflicted and halt the merging process. To see the list of conflicted files run git status on your terminal. Definitions conflict is what you get when two or more people have differences, real or perceived, that are not resolved. Weve all seen situations where people with different goals and needs have clashed, and weve all witnessed the often intense personal animosity that can. Conflict resolution skills are required for a wide range of positions across many job sectors.
Conflicts only affect the developer conducting the merge, the rest of the team is unaware of the conflict. Over time, peoples conflict management styles tend to mesh, and a right way to solve conflict emerges. Pdf resolving conflicts is the main challenge for software merging. A conflict is a situation when the interests, needs, goals or values of involved parties interfere with one another. Since relationship conflicts are inevitable, learning. Among conflict management techniques, collaboration has one major disadvantage.
Conflict management skills are probably the hardest interpersonal skills to master constructively. Of all the techniques covered in this article, creative problem solving takes the most time and energy. When you understand how you handle conflict, you can begin to understand when your approach is. A facilitation guide to effective conflict resolution.
Five conflict management styles gateway fellowship. Here is the conflict resolution process in five steps. Approaches to conflict resolution, as applied to international environmental disputes, include negotiation, mediation and arbitration. When conflict is mismanaged, it can cause great harm to a relationship, but when handled in a respectful, positive way, conflict. Conflict resolution fundamentals 3 terms and definitions conflict response styles how you choose to respond to a conflict generally follows a progression. Use it to guide your actions in a way that produces a peaceful solution in time of disagreement.
The more you attempt to resolve conflict, the more confident you become in your ability, and the more. They follow different informal processes to avoid encountering, or having to resolve. Here are 5 conflict resolution strategies that are more effective. In the workplace, conflicts are common and inevitable.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. All the members need to realise that dived they stand, united they fall. For those involved, the outcome of the conflict resolution is less stressful however, the process of finding and establishing a winwin.
The area of conflict resolution is broad and it is felt the question of whether conflict resolution is fair and just to all. The importance of conflict resolution techniques in autonomous agile teams xp 18 companion, may 2125, 2018, porto, portugal 17. Conflict resolution strategies free ppt and pdf downloads. Learning to resolve it effectively, in a way that does not. Definitions conflict resolution is what we do to identify.
Depending on how we handle conflict, the outcome may changewe can influence conflicts outcome in many positive ways. Conflict can be good or bad depending on how we learn to deal with it. The interestbased relational approach when conflict arises, its easy for people to get entrenched in their positions and for tempers to flare, voices to rise, and body language to become defensive or aggressive. These were based on two conflict management dimensions. According to the pmbok guide, conflict is inevitable in a project environment. To do this, it helps to understand one of the key processes for effective conflict resolution. Negotiation is generally defined as a communication process we use to reach a. Individuals can identify their primary style, and assess. Sep 29, 20 conflict resolution strategies strategies is the process of resolving a dispute by addressing and meeting at least some of each sides needs and concerns its an indispensable process to create a productive work place and effective team dynamics. In merge replication, conflict resolution takes place at the article level. Operationbased merging introduction 2 existing merge tools. Conflicted lines of the files will be marked with visual indicators.
Thomas1 described five modes of conflict resolution. The thomas kilmann conflict mode instrument is one of the most effective conflict management strategies ive seen. The reader should recognize that methods of conflict resolution such as media tion, problem solving, and problem management are defined by this author as nonconventional because these are methods that are underutilized in police work. Committed group members attempt to resolve group conflicts by actively communicating information about their conflicting motives or ideologies to the rest of group e. Summary points conflict is a part of lifeit can be a positive. To change the resolution, click in the override field. Conflict resolution with case studies reports cipd.
Conflict resolution strategies linkedin slideshare. Conflict resolution training a step by step guide for how to resolve git merge conflicts this git tutorials provides a practical approach for understanding what git merge conflicts are and how. On the free online course, how to resolve conflicts, find out. This requirement is based around the fact that conflict tends to reduce productivity and create a difficult work environment, leading to unwanted turnover in staff and reduced morale. Developers are aware of the problems posed by merge conflict resolutions. Weve all seen situations where different people with different goals. Conflict management techniques from the pmbok guide project. It is based on a model of conflict modes, which enables an analysis of individual styles in particular situations. In the agile soware development context, the process facilitator i. Address the procedures for dealing with the conflict policies, intervention strategies etc. Conflict resolution skills whatever the cause of disagreements and disputes, by learning these skills, you can keep your personal and professional relationships strong and growing. The art of conflict resolution has, and quite deservedly, been the topic of much debate in terms of its implications for team building and group dynamics as well as for related organizational issues. Conflict resolution and mediation learn more about how to effectively resolve conflict and mediate personal relationships at home, at work and socially. Conflict management techniques from the pmbok guide.
Summary points conflict is a part of lifeit can be a positive part of life, an instrument of growth. When you have two branches with changes to the same file and you try to merge them, a merge conflict will occur. Conflict management styles and strategies collaborating uses 1. Communicate your feelings assertively, not aggressively. Resolve conflicts by imposing an ordering on the prim itive transformations. Deal effectively with anger you cant negotiate an agreement if you andor the other person are too angry to think straight or acknowledge your feelings. Malthus, the eminent economist says that reduced supply of the means of subsistence is the root cause of conflict. When you need to find an integrative solution and the concerns of both parties are too important to be compromised 2. Patrol police officer conflict resolution processes. Conflict resolution resolving conflict rationally and effectively in many cases, conflict seems to be a fact of life.
Competing accommodating compromising collaborating avoiding. It is then the developers responsibility to resolve the conflict. Understanding conflict conflict is a normal part of any healthy relationship. It is also known as the conflict resolution inventory. Learning how to handle disputes efficiently is a necessary skill for anyone in management and the key to preventing it from hindering employees professional growth.
Conflict resolution skills managing and resolving conflict in a positive way conflict is a normal, and even healthy, part of relationships. Perspectives on merge software practitioner conflicts and. Participants will learn about the conflict resolution. Developers need to resolve these conflicts before completing the. After defining the problem, the pmbok guide suggests five techniques for project management. Conflict resolution skills edmonds community college. This worksheet is designed to help you resolve conflict through use of effective communication. Conflict management conflict resolution techniques. Workplace conflict resolution tips and strategies for managers and hr workplace conflict is one of the greatest causes of employee stress. Explain 5 conflict management techniques in the workplace. The key is not to avoid conflict but to learn how to resolve it in.
Read pdf conflict resolution book conflict resolution book conflict resolution life can be frustrating. Conflict is a normal part of any healthy relationship. The importance of conflict resolution techniques in. The query displays a list of all object properties in which there is a conflict. For publications composed of several articles, you can have different conflict resolvers serving different articles, or the same conflict resolver serving one article, several articles, or all the articles comprising a publication. Taking simple steps to resolve conflict immediately. These techniques find duplicates automatically by evaluating the data that is available. Predicting merge conflicts in collaborative software. Conflict with in a family can be resolved if the members recognize and respect roles of family members. Reflect on your own experience in dealing with conflict situations and make notes below about your own strengths. Conflict management conflict resolution techniques negotiation skills. Oct 23, 2019 when i was studying conflict resolution techniques, i observed a discrepancy between the pmp exam reference books and the pmbok guide. Facilitation guide for effective conflict resolution.
Probably a family friend may intervene to resolve the dispute if the members fail to resolve the. In the attribute differences list, click in the conflict field so that a check mark appears. A merge can enter a conflicted state at two separate points. Workplace conflict resolution tips and strategies for managers wishing to resolve basic workplace conflict meet with all of the people involved individually as above. Conflicts often lead to a negotiating process between you and other people. Even though no method performs with perfect accu racy, satisfying results. Also make notes about your growing edge, or the things you need to work on in order to effectively facilitate constructive conflict in your team as a leader. The conflict management skills workbook whole person. Deep down, we know that this conflict resolution approach usually fails to resolve the conflict and often only makes it worse. Based on your individual meetings you will now have a clearer picture of the key issues, what each person considers important and the common ground.
It may be at your own expense and actually work against your own goals, objectives, and desired outcomes. Conflict resolution training a step by step guide for how to resolve git merge conflicts this git tutorials provides a practical approach for understanding what git merge conflicts are and how to fix them. Examines changes in employers use of different methods of managing individual conflict and how far recent changes in legislation on dispute resolution, including the introduction of employment tribunal fees, have impacted employer practices. Accommodating this is when you cooperate to a highdegree. Conflict resolution is conceptualized as the methods and processes involved in facilitating the peaceful ending of conflict and retribution. Competing accommodating compromising collaborating. Focus on the issue, not your position about the issue. Conflict resolution in groups resolving intragroup conflict. After all, two people cant be expected to agree on everything at all times.
Here, then, is the tool you can use to discover the source of any conflict and resolve it. When your objective is to learn and you wish to test your assumptions and understand others views 3. Understanding conflict resolution hilal ahmad wani research scholar department of political science. After all, two people cant be expected to agree on.
Without conflict resolution skills, we tend to alternate between styles 1 and 2. Conflict management 086 resolving git rebase conflict lab git merge vs rebase understand the differences between merge and rebase and learn you can use these commands in your. Conflict occurs between people in all kinds of human relationships and in all social settings. The four contributors to the conflict resolution theme are all outstanding researchers in the field of environmental decisionmaking. A conflict resolution process based on these approaches, a starting point for dealing with conflict is to identify the overriding conflict style employed by yourself, your team or your organization. Simply choose git from the left nav and then install the ksdiff commandline tool and then make kaleidoscope gits default diff and merge tool.
406 1161 1506 1139 885 1541 276 1438 1100 233 668 839 1129 1121 586 1513 1379 337 473 187 111 1542 671 660 119 322 534 914 383 1347 339 888 902 1269 675 1519 699 1344 1511 486 377 1044 1367 1044 728 1433 861 198 7